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: All patients undergoing urologic surgeries involving urethral manipulation (endourological procedures/urethral catheterization) with no significant ( >100000 cfu) growth on urine culture.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Patients unwilling to give consent for inclusion in the study. Age 75 years. Expected indwelling catheter duration of more than 1 week. Emergency procedures. Pre-existing infection focus at the time of surgery. Uncontrolled diabetes mellitus, immune-suppression or any other non-urological disease pre-disposing to higher risk for infections. Urethral reconstructive surgeries or genital/perineal/rectal approach to surgery
